As America approaches its 250th anniversary, the companies will pursue the development of scalable seedling technologies to support the first-ever restoration of a native tree species from functional extinction.
BOSTON, MA AND CAMBRIDGE, MA / ACCESS Newswire / June 29, 2026 / Today, SilvaBio, the forest biotechnology company that develops, produces, and sells disease-tolerant hardwood seedlings, and Foray Bioscience, a plant biomanufacturing company growing plant products from the cell up, announce a collaboration focused on exploring how producing fabricated seeds can accelerate the restoration of the American chestnut.
This partnership will pair SilvaBio's genetics expertise, accelerated breeding, and restoration platform with Foray's fabricated seed technology, which grows encapsulated plant embryos from plant cells that can be sown like a conventional seed to produce a whole tree. Together, they aim to develop scalable technologies designed to support the growing demand for American chestnut seedlings across the species' 200-million-acre native range.
The American chestnut was once among the most abundant and economically valuable trees in North America. In the early twentieth century, over four billion trees were lost following the introduction of chestnut blight, rendering the species functionally extinct and fundamentally altering forest ecosystems, wildlife habitat, and rural economies it supported.
More than a century on, the American chestnut could now become the first tree species ever returned from functional extinction--made possible by advances in blight-tolerant breeding. SilvaBio's work builds upon the pioneering technology of the Darling 54, developed by its research partners at SUNY College of Environmental Science and Forestry (ESF). Blight tolerance of the line has been rigorously tested and confirmed by independent studies conducted at SUNY ESF, Purdue University, and the University of New England.
Today, SilvaBio continues to advance restoration by moving the Darling line from the lab to real-world deployment. Using genomic prediction, accelerated breeding, and advanced micropropagation, the company is developing a broad portfolio of American chestnut genetics designed to maximize diversity, adaptability, and long-term resilience. SilvaBio intends to leverage this breakthrough through the production, sale, and deployment of improved American chestnut seedlings to landowners, conservation organizations, government agencies, and forestry professionals, pending deregulation.

The American chestnut is just one of several hardwood species threatened by invasive pests and diseases. Billions of additional seedlings are needed to support reforestation and forest restoration efforts, underscoring a critical need for improved seedlings and new approaches to forest recovery. SilvaBio's broader technology platform is designed to address this challenge, accelerating development of improved hardwood cultivars across other species facing similar pressures, including ash, oak, elm, and walnut. Demand for optimized seedlings at scale will only continue to grow as forest owners and land managers seek solutions to disease, climate, and reforestation challenges.
That is where Foray comes in. Under the signed agreement, Foray will develop fabricated seeds for SilvaBio's blight-tolerant American chestnut lines. The agreement outlines a multi-year development and production roadmap between the two companies.
